Alan Modra authored
There isn't really any good reason for code in rdcoff.c to distinguish between "basic" types and any other type. This patch dispenses with the array reserved for basic types and instead handles all types using coff_get_slot, simplifying the code. * rdcoff.c (struct coff_types, coff_slots): Merge. Delete coff_slots. (T_MAX): Delete. (parse_coff_base_type): Use coff_get_slot to store baseic types. (coff_get_slot, parse_coff_type, parse_coff_base_type), (parse_coff_struct_type, parse_coff_enum_type), (parse_coff_symbol, parse_coff): Pass types as coff_types**.
